For the academic year 2022-2023, total 608 students are attending the school and the school offers campus housing facilities (i.e. dormitory and residence halls possessed by the school). Key academic stats for the school are listed in the next table.

Special Learning Opportunities and On-Campus Student Services

Covenant Theological Seminary offers online classes (distance learning opportunities) for graduate programs.

Campus Life

The following table illustrates the special characteristics of CTS. Covenant Theological Seminary is religiously affiliated with The Presbyterian Church in America. It has dormitories (or campus-owned housing) and its capacity is 181. It also offers separate board/meal plans.
